Budgeting for a Home Addition in Toronto: A Step-by-Step Guide
Assess Your Needs
Before allocating a budget for your home addition, it’s essential to determine your needs. Are you adding a new bedroom or bathroom? Are you expanding your living area or creating a home office? The type and size of your addition will ultimately determine the cost. Consider using online home improvement calculators that will give you an estimated cost for each project.
Create a Budget
Once you’ve determined your specific needs, create a budget that is realistic and feasible to follow. The rule of thumb is to allocate 10-20% of your home’s value towards the home addition. Ensure that your budget includes all costs, such as permits, labor, materials, and potential unexpected expenses. A detailed budget will help you stay on track and avoid overspending. Hire a Professional Contractor
A professional contractor is the key to a successful home addition project. Hire a licensed, experienced, and reputable contractor in your area. A reliable contractor will help you create a budget and guide you through all the necessary steps of your home addition project. Ask your contractor for a detailed quote that includes all anticipated costs, materials, labor, project timeline, and payment schedule.
Finance Your Home Addition
There are different financing options available for home additions, including home equity loans, personal loans, and lines of credit. It’s essential to explore all options and compare interest rates and fees before deciding which financing option works best for you. Moreover, make sure to include any loan payments in your budget and ensure you have a plan to repay the loan to avoid getting into debt.
Account for Hidden Costs
Unexpected expenses, such as material shortages, additional labor, or weather delays, can arise and add to your home addition cost. It’s crucial to allocate a portion of your budget, about 10-15%, to account for unforeseen expenses. Remember that extra expenses are a part of any home improvement project and be prepared financially to handle any surprises.
Choose the Right Materials
Your home addition’s materials play a significant role in the cost, overall design, and functionality of your addition. Choose durable materials that will last for years and offer value for your money. Consult with your contractor and discuss the quality of materials you can afford that fits your style and budget. Choose a design that complements your home’s existing architecture and adds value to your property.
